Treatment Overview
IVF with donor sperm is a full in vitro fertilization cycle in which the sperm used for fertilizing the eggs comes from a carefully screened donor. The process involves ovarian stimulation (or synchronization), egg retrieval, fertilization (often via ICSI), embryo culture, and embryo transfer into the recipient’s uterus. Ideal Candidates
This treatment is suitable for:
- Couples where the male partner has no usable sperm (azoospermia)
- Individuals with severe sperm defects or genetic abnormalities
- Single women or same-sex female couples wishing to become pregnant
- Patients who prefer not to rely on sperm retrieval methods or whose partner cannot produce viable sperm
- Couples with previous IVF failures suspected to be linked to sperm factors

Possible Risks & Complications
The risks are similar to those of standard IVF, with some additional considerations related to donor sperm protocols:
- Ovarian stimulation risks (OHSS, medication side effects)
- Egg retrieval risks (bleeding, infection, discomfort)
- Embryo transfer risks (spotting, cramping)
- Multiple pregnancies if more than one embryo is transferred
- Potential embryo damage during micromanipulation or ICSI
- Emotional and ethical complexities associated with donor selection and anonymity
- Slight possibility of genetic risk if donor screening is incomplete (thus stringent screening is crucial)

Techniques & Methods Used
Korean fertility centers employ cutting-edge techniques in IVF with donor sperm:
- ICSI (Intracytoplasmic Sperm Injection): Direct injection of one donor sperm into each mature egg to maximize fertilization
- Time-Lapse Embryo Monitoring & AI Selection: Continuous monitoring of embryo development with AI scoring to pick the most viable embryos
- Blastocyst Culture: Extended culture to day 5 or 6 to allow natural selection of stronger embryos
- Preimplantation Genetic Testing (PGT-A / PGT-M): Optional screening of embryos for chromosomal or single-gene abnormalities
- Vitrification of Surplus Embryos: High-survival freezing for future use
- Robotic or Automated Lab Systems and Traceability: Ensuring sample integrity and minimization of human error
- High-precision lab environment controls: Strict temperature, gas mix, and contamination prevention

Recovery & Aftercare
Recovery largely mirrors that of conventional IVF:
- Mild discomfort, bloating, or cramping after egg retrieval, usually resolving within a day or two
- Short rest after embryo transfer followed by gradual resumption of normal activity
- Hormone support (progesterone, estrogen) continued during the early implantation period
- Blood tests (β-hCG) around 10–14 days post-transfer to confirm pregnancy
- Ultrasound follow-up to verify implant and fetal development
- Lifestyle guidance, nutritional support, and psychological counseling throughout

Cost Range
Estimated costs for IVF with donor sperm in Korea vary with complexity and add-on services:
- Basic donor sperm IVF cycle (no genetic testing): USD 7,000 to 12,000
- With PGT (genetic screening of embryos): USD 10,000 to 15,000+
- Embryo freezing and storage: additional USD 1,000 to 2,000
- Donor sperm procurement and processing fees: USD 500 to 2,000
- Multi-cycle or bundled program packages may reduce the per-cycle cost
